Transaction d675cddd4d6218ad098879703302fa51fc851a2d7c8e7ccf9ddad1063d2c83cb
1 Input
1 Output
-
d675cddd4d6218ad098879703302fa51fc851a2d7c8e7ccf9ddad1063d2c83cb:0
- value
- 16997809
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9273de682e323808086a131e5b19e7824e9dfbe8 OP_EQUAL
- address
- 3F3PPFjJY4V5ZAhCUAQpwgQUx9DzBHTxDu